Description
A quick and luxurious cheese tortellini dish coated in a creamy, restaurant-quality sauce with sun-dried tomatoes and parmesan, delivering indulgent flavor in just 30 minutes.
Ingredients
Pasta
- 500 g cheese tortellini
Sauce
- 2 tbsp butter
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1/2 cup grated parmesan
- 1/2 cup sun-dried tomatoes, chopped
- 1/2 tsp Italian seasoning
- Salt and pepper to taste
Garnish
- Fresh basil for garnish
Instructions
- Cook Tortellini: Cook the cheese tortellini according to the package instructions until al dente, then drain and set aside.
- Sauté Garlic: In a pan, melt the butter over medium heat, then add the minced garlic and sauté until fragrant, about 1-2 minutes, being careful not to burn it.
- Create Sauce: Pour the heavy cream into the pan and bring it to a gentle simmer, stirring occasionally to prevent sticking.
- Add Flavorings: Stir in the grated parmesan, chopped sun-dried tomatoes, Italian seasoning, and season with salt and pepper to taste. Continue to simmer until the sauce thickens slightly, about 3-5 minutes.
- Toss Tortellini: Add the cooked tortellini to the pan and toss thoroughly to coat them evenly in the creamy sauce.
- Garnish and Serve: Remove from heat, garnish with fresh basil leaves, and serve immediately for best flavor and texture.
Notes
- Add fresh spinach in step 4 for extra color and nutrition, allowing it to wilt in the sauce.
- Using refrigerated tortellini ensures a better texture compared to frozen.
- Adjust salt and pepper seasoning toward the end based on your taste preference.
- Serve immediately to maintain the creaminess of the sauce.
